MEMORANDUM OPINION

Jack H. Carr has filed a petition for writ of mandamus with accompanying request for emergency relief. This Court previously stayed the underlying proceedings and execution of any writ of possession that may have issued, pending a response to Carr's petition by the real party in interest. Having considered Carr's petition and the response filed by the real party in interest, we lift the stay and deny Carr's petition for writ of mandamus.

See In Re Carr, No. 03-14-00705-CV (Tex. App.—Austin Nov. 7, 2014, order) (per curiam) (orig. proceeding), available at http://www.txcourts.gov/3rdcoa.

See Tex R. App. P. 52.8(a).
